State Senator Jack Kibbie Escapes Injury In Car Wreck

November 22, 2014

(Perry)– Senate Democratic President Jack Kibbie has escaped injury in a car wreck in central Iowa.

The Dallas County Sheriff’s Office says the 75-year-old Emmetsburg Democrat apparently fell asleep and lost control of his car on state highway 141 just west of Perry Sunday afternoon.

Officials say his car crossed the highway, hit a cable guardrail, breaking 12 poles and about 210 feet of guardrail.

Kibbie wasn’t hurt.

The mishap took place around 3:00 p.m. Sunday.
